Enabling Wireless Reconciliation

With wireless reconciliation, you don't need to delete the same e-mail in two
places. The two e-mail inboxes reconcile with each other — hence, the term
wireless reconciliation. Convenient, huh?

Enabling wireless e-mail synchronization

You can start wireless e-mail synchronization by configuring your BlackBerry:
1. From the Home screen, touch-press Messages.
The Messages application opens, and you see the message list.
2. In the message list, press the menu key and touch-press Options.
3. Touch-press Email Reconciliation.
The Email Reconciliation screen opens, with the following options:
4. For the Delete On option, touch-press one of the following:
• Delete On: Configures how BlackBerry handles e-mail deletion.
• Wireless Reconciliation: Turns on or off the wireless sync function.
• On Conflict: Controls how BlackBerry handles any inconsistencies
between e-mail on your BlackBerry and the BIS client.
You can choose who "wins" via the Email Reconciliation option:
your BlackBerry or the BIS client.
• Handheld: A delete on your BlackBerry takes effect on your
BlackBerry only.
• Mailbox & Handheld: A delete on your BlackBerry takes effect on
both your BlackBerry and your inbox on the BIS client.
• Prompt: This option makes BlackBerry ask you to confirm at the
time of deletion.
